Operations teams rarely lack effort. They lack reliable handoffs between systems that were never designed to speak to each other. We consult on Python automation that fits how your people already move freight, tickets, and shift notes — not on abstract “digital transformation.”
Our work stays close to Bangkok-area operations: plant floors, shared inboxes, and the quiet hours when a missing file still means a missed truck. When we propose automation, we name the owner, the fallback when a feed fails, and the training the next supervisor will need.

A regional fulfillment desk was stitching five CSV exports into one morning board. We rebuilt the pull as a small Python job with logged failures, so the board still appeared when one upstream file arrived late.
